A Longines 18ct gold gentleman's wristwatch, circa 1960s, the pale silvered dial with Arabic numerals at 2, 4, 6, 8 and 12 o'clock, interspersed with golden arrowheads, gold tapering hands, with subsidiary seconds dial, inside casebase stamped '6113 1 37' '18K 0.750', with hammer head mark (marteau sans manche) for maker Jacques Beiner, and Helvetia head 18K grade mark on rolled gold bracelet strap with deployment clasp and several additional links, case 32mm, 64.0g.
Notes: in working condition, winds and hands set well, keeps time across 1hr test, however Batemans cannot guarantee its continued operation.
